U+6150 "慐" CJK Unified Ideograph-# is a rare and historically obscure Chinese character that appears in the Kangxi Dictionary and other classical works, typically interpreted as a variant form of the character "恭" (gōng), meaning respect or reverence. It combines the radical "心" (heart or mind) on the bottom with a phonetic component on top, and its usage is primarily found in historical texts and proper names, with no widely recognized meaning or common application in modern Chinese, Japanese, or Korean languages.
